To apply for B.E./B.Tech at Pallavan College of Engineering, follow these steps:
- Register for TNEA: visit their official site and complete the registration process.
- Submit Required Details: Fill in academic and personal information, including Class 12 marks.
- Participate in Counselling: Once the TNEA rank list is published, participate in the online counselling process.
- Choose Pallavan College: Select Pallavan College of Engineering as your preference during the choice-filling step.
- Seat Allotment: If your rank meets the cutoff, you will receive a seat allotment?

The TNEA 2024 cutoff for Pallavan College of Engineering for B.E./B.Tech varies by branch and category. For example:
- B.E. in Computer Science and Engineering: Closing ranks reached 196746 in Round 3.
- B.E. in Civil Engineering: The cutoff was 124785 in Round 4.
- B.E. in Electronics and Communication Engineering: The cutoff rank in Round 3 was 177141.
These cutoffs vary by year and round of counseling. For the most accurate details, refer to the uploaded document or the official TNEA website.

Hi, Pallavan College of Engineering offers diverse extracurricular activities to promote holistic development among students. Key initiatives include:
- Clubs and Societies: National Service Scheme (NSS), Youth Red Cross (YRC), and Red Ribbon Club (RRC) for community service and social engagement.
- Cultural Activities: Events for singing, dancing, drama, literature, and art are regularly organized, alongside vibrant celebrations of festivals and annual college fests.
- Sports Facilities: Facilities for indoor games like carrom and chess, and outdoor activities such as badminton and cricket.

Hi, Pallavan College of Engineering (PCE), Kanchipuram, has an active placement cell that connects students with reputable companies. Top recruiters include Infosys, TCS, CTS, HCL, and others. The average salary package is around INR 2.5–3 LPA, with the highest package reaching INR 6–7 LPA in some cases. The college also emphasizes training, including soft skills and industry internships, to enhance employability.

The B.E./B.Tech fees at Pallavan College of Engineering, Kanchipuram, is approximately INR 55,000 per year, amounting to a total of INR 2,20,000 for the 4-year program. Fees may vary based on factors like reservations or scholarships, and additional charges such as bus or exam fees might apply.
